ISLAMABAD (Daily Dunya) – Azad Kashmir has been declared as ‘occupied’ in Social Studies’ book of fifth grade in various private schools.

Sources told that government has not taken any action against the publishers however, Private Educational Institutions Regulatory Authority (PEIRA) has banned the book.

On the other hand,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) Senator Sehar Kamran has informed the higher authorities about the mistake.

“We are leading our future to the wrong direction as we are doing such things which our enemies want to do”, he added.

The publishers have also formally apologized to the PEIRA.
